Dodgers' Shohei Ohtani matches Clayton Kershaw in baseball history originally appeared on The Sporting News . Add The Sporting News as a Preferred Source by clicking here . The Los Angeles Dodgers took a disappointing loss in their series finale Wednesday in Toronto against the Blue Jays.

It wasn't really Shohei Ohtani 's fault, though. He had a quality outing on the mound. Ohtani went 6.

0 innings, allowing four hits, one walk and no earned runs. He struck out just two hitters. It's actually a bit of a rare stat line.

It's the 25th time in baseball history a pitcher went 6-4-0-1-2, according to Pitchergami on X . The fun factoid with this stat beyond that: The last time an MLB pitcher had those exact stats was Aug. 18, 2024, when Clayton Kershaw did it.
